A new parking regulation has come into force on Ramón Gallud Street in central Torrevieja. The measure applies from Tuesday 15 September and limits parking to two hours on weekdays between 8am and 8pm.
Outside the regulated hours, from 8pm to 8am, drivers can park without a time limit. The restriction also does not apply on non-working days.
Federico Alarcón, the city council’s councillor for the Local Police, said the change aims to improve vehicle turnover during the busiest hours. This should allow more people to find spaces while shopping, carrying out errands or using services in the town centre.
The council has installed new signs showing the parking hours and conditions. Drivers have been asked to check the signs carefully and respect the two-hour limit during the regulated period.
